Ties record for most wins in a season (#62, next best was #50). Is the sure bet favorite to win the Stanley Cup.
...Then gets swept in 1st round by the lowly Columbus Blue Jackets. Outscored 19-8 in a 4 game series. Un - Bee - lievable.

Just saw this at Sporting News: "The Tampa Bay Lightning are the first team in NHL history to win the Presidents’ Trophy and then be swept out of the first round." "Tampa Bay entered the playoffs as the heavy favorite to take home the Stanley Cup as it had one of the best regular seasons ever. But, it was shockingly overpowered by Columbus in one of the biggest upsets in NHL history." Sporting News reports that this "was the first postseason series victory for the Blue Jackets franchise." (team began play in 2000-01)
